Active Ingredient

White Petrolatum 100%

Purpose

Skin Protectant

Use(s)

• Temporarily protects minor cuts, scrapes, and burns

• Temporarily protects and helps relieve chafed, chapped, or cracked skin and lips

• Helps prevent and protect from the drying effects of wind and cold weather

• Protects chafed skin due to diaper rash

Warnings

For External Use Only

Do not use on

• Deep or puncture wounds

• Animal bites

• Serious burns

When using this product

Avoid contact with eyes

Stop use and ask a doctor if

• Condition worsens

• Symptoms last more than 7 days or clear up and occur again within a few days

Keep out of reach of children.

If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center (1-800-222-1222) right away.

Directions

• For diaper rash: Change wet and soiled diapers promptly, cleanse the diaper area, and allow to dry. Apply liberally as often as necessary with each diaper change, especially at bedtime or anytime when exposure to wet diapers may be prolonged.

• For other uses: Apply as needed.

Other Information

• Store at room temperature 15º-30ºC (59º-86ºF)

• Avoid excessive heat

• Tamper evident. Do not use if packet is torn, cut, or opened.
